If you pursue a master's degree in health care management, you won't be alone. The field of study is the #12 most popular program in the country. This means there are lots of options to choose from when you decide to get your degree.

College Factual looked at 7 colleges and universities when compiling its 2024 Best Health Care Management Master's Degree Schools in Missouri ranking. Combined, these schools handed out 226 master's degrees in health care management to qualified students.

A Great Overall School

A school that excels in educating for a particular major and degree level must be a great school overall as well. To make it into this list a school must rank well in our overall Best Colleges for a Master's Degree ranking. This ranking considered factors such as graduation rates, overall graduate earnings and other educational resources to identify great colleges and universities.
